1. Acknowledge Romans 3:23
For all have sinned and come short of the glory of God
2. Confess 1 John 1:9, Matthew 10:32-33
If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us our
sins and cleanse us from all unrighteousness.
3. Repent Act 3:19, Act 2:28
Repent ye there and be converted, that your sins may be blotted
out when the times of refreshing shall come from the presence
of the Lord
4. Believe Romans 10:9
That if thou shalt confess with thy mouth the Lord Jesus, and
shalt believe in thine heart that God hath raised him from the
dead, thou shalt be saved.
5. Receive John1:12, Act 2:38
But as many as received him, to them gave he the power to become the sons of God even to them that believe in his name.
6. Forsake Isaiah 55:7
LET THE WICKED FORSAKE HIS WAY AND THE
UNRIGHTEOUS MAN HIS THOUGHTS: AND LET HIM
RETURN UNTO THE Lord, and he will have mercy upon him,
and to our God, for he will abundantly pardon.
7. Be Baptize Mark: 16:16 Galatians 3:26:27
He that believeth and is baptized shall be saved: but he that
believeth not shall be damned (doomed to eternal punishment)
